Note 1: The two terminals [L] are electrically connected together inside the inverter.
Note 2: We recommend using [L] logic GND (to the right) for logic input circuits and [L]
analog GND (to the left) for analog I/O circuits.

Note: If relay is connected to intelligent output, install a diode across the relay coil
(reverse-biased) in order to suppress the turn-off spike.
Caution for intelligent terminals setting
Please avoid conducting below procedure, because if you follow procedure describe below, the
inverter setting will be initialized.
1) Turning on power while [Intelligent input terminal 1/2/3 are ON] and [Intelligent input
terminal 4/5/6/7 are OFF].
2) After 1)’s condition, turning off power.
3) After 2)'s condition, turning on power while [Intelligent input terminal 2/3/4 are ON]
and [Intelligent input terminal 1/5/6/7 are OFF].
